Abstract

We analyze the cosmological initial-state limit of the P2 action (Paper I) by integrating the coupled Friedmann–Klein-Gordon system from high redshift (z ~ 22,000) to the far future (a ~ 15). The early universe corresponds to the high-coherence limit C → 1 of the scalar coherence field, where the potential VB(C) vanishes, the field energy density is negligible compared to radiation and matter, and all dynamical variables remain regular. The geometric singularity (a → 0, rho → infinity) persists as in standard GR; however, the Big Bang corresponds to the high-coherence limit C → 1, where the fundamental coherence field approaches its maximal value smoothly.
